What time does destiny reset?

Destiny 2’s weekly resets always happen at the same time. They occur every Tuesday at 12 p.m. Eastern / 9 a.m. Pacific. Resets happen at that time on the dot, so you’ll usually always see changes take place right away when you log in….

Can you repeat heroic adventures Destiny 2?

For those that want to replay Adventures, your only option is the Heroic versions on the Flashpoint planet. Note that Adventures are only available on the Flashpoint planet. This severely limits your options. For the weekly reset on August 11, 2020, the Flashpoint is Mercury….

How do you get heroic adventures in Destiny Titan 2?

First you need to complete all of the regular adventures on the designated planets. Once you do that go to that planet’s vendor. Either on the first page or second page of their inventory there will be 5 icons with the 5th one being outlined in purple. That one is a Heroic Story adventure….

What is the flashpoint rotation Destiny 2?

As it stands right now in Season of Dawn, the rotation of Flashpoints is Mercury, Nessus, Titan, Mars, EDZ, Tangled Shore, and Io….

How do you access daily heroic story missions?

First, open your Director and click on the Vanguard symbol. Now, click on the icon on on the left of the screen. This is the Heroic Story Mission option. Now, select the mission you wish to play.

Where are the daily heroic missions in destiny?

There will be three activity selections: -Heroic Story missions (left side) -Strike Playlist (middle) -Nightfall (right side) When you select the heroic story missions, you will see the bottom right displaying the name of a story mission, and the recommended light level.
